This research examined how bamboo truck ash (BTA)/grinded snail shell (GSS) can be use as partial replacement of cement in self-compacting concrete. One hundred and Twenty (120) specimens were produce, the water-powder (cement+GSS+BTA) ratios were 15%BTA/0%GSS, 10%BTA/5%GSS, 5%BTA/10%GSS, 0%BTA/15%GSS, and SP430 from 0%, 1%, 2% and 3% while other mix components were kept constant. Laboratory investigation results showed that sample at 7 days, 1 % COMPLAST SP430 and 2% bamboo trunk ash/grinded snail shell, the maximum average compressive strength was 8.81N/mm2 also at 28 days 1%, 2 % bamboo trunk/grinded snail shell, maximum average compressive strength was 19.85N/mm2. Self-compacting concrete criteria on the fresh concrete mix ratio show that at 2% and 3% SP430 complast (as super plasticizer) addition with 15/0, 10/5 and satisfied self-compacting concrete criteria. Compressive strength of concrete was obtained within the range of 15N/mm2 to 18.74N/mm2.The strength was examined using standard deviation and they were within the acceptable limits. The significance of this work lies in its attempt to provide information on the performance of self-compacting concrete and its major advantages in saving time, labor and environmentally friendly as noise from vibrator is completely eliminated.
